A Technical Writer may also find work writing SOPs, which are detailed step-by-step instructions for a business. These documents are used to improve a business’s efficiency and consistency. SOPs can outline everything from client onboarding to restaurant closing to testing alarm systems. SOPs are used in businesses of all sizes, and technical writers who specialize in writing SOPs can find plenty of work in these fields.

Once you have a client, you should negotiate your rate. For highly technical projects, you may want to price per word or per hour. Before negotiating, you should know the average rate for similar projects. Before negotiating, determine the minimum rate you can expect to charge. Always prepare a contract for any project you do as this protects both parties. Make sure to specify the scope of work, content ownership, deadlines, and revision policy. Some clients may require non-compete agreements and confidentiality clauses.

Once you’ve found a client, you’ll need to negotiate on a rate. Technical writing is more complex than most types of writing, and freelancers who are more specialized in the field can command a higher rate. Rates on Upwork for technical writers vary from $15 per hour to $125 per hour. The rate of each freelancer varies greatly, but most work falls between $30 and $60 per hour. The rate is often determined by the content and the time required.
